Until now I'm configuring all installed Dahua cameras with Variable Bit Rate (VBR), as it seems a good compromise between image quality and disk space. With VBR the images I see momentary slight blurred frames on major bit rate oscillations, but final result is more than acceptable.

But I've just installed another unit of DH-IPC-HDW3449H-AS-PV-S3, the 4MPx TIOC unit that I've placed before in another premises with very good results, and I was really surprised with the very bad image quality using VBR in day condition: in a static scene the image goes completely blurred for 1 or 2 seconds each 5/7 seconds, that disappears changing to CBR. And no blur in night black&white IR mode.

I've configured both cameras identically, and both have same firmware version, the latest from Dahua. They have very similar light conditions and both scenes are quiet, in fact the preexisting one that works well with VBR is having more motion moments that the new one.

Why is this happening ? Any explanation ?
 
Setting CBR solves the issue. But I've also discovered that some VBR configured cameras that were working well for weeks have now this issue, even after reboot.

Very strange...
